Sclerotinia sclerotiorum belongs to Ascomycotina, Helotiales, Sclerotinia, a worldwide plant pathogen which could parasitize in more than 400 different host plant species.Due to the lack of the natural environment can be used in the practice of Sclerotinia resistance germplasm resources, host of Sclerotinia sclerotiorum resistance is controlled by multiple genes and genetic mechanisms for interaction between the complex. Practice has proved that the disease occurred after the production of chemical control is the only effective control measures. Disease is mainly spread of Sclerotinia sclerotiorum ascospores in the sexual stage of a disk wind Ascospore release of the spread of disease to increase the spread of Sclerotinia sclerotiorum. The study is particularly important phase of sexual reproduction.The main role of the mating types, common to all studied ascomycetes, is to control the recognition mechanism leading to fertilization and the evolution. Each of the mating type idiomorphs (MAT-1 and MAT-2) consists of approximately 1.2 kb of unique DNA flanked by sequences that are almost identical between chromosomes, which are alpha-box and HMG-box, conserve sequence in mating gene. In this study, we constructed phylogenetic tree of 227 species of Ascomycotina fungi baseing on alpha-box and HMG-box sequence and do analysis about the relationship of evolution between them which were in high conformity. Deep Hypha phylogenetic tree focused on the same major loci, including the well characterized nuclear rRNA genes, and the protein-coding loci tef1 and rpb1 and rpb2.The analysis results are as same as the front.This article focuses on Sclerotinia sclerotiorum MAT mating type genes have been studied for the genetic analysis of Sclerotinia sclerotiorum work laid the foundation. In this study, the left and right select the MAT gene flanking sequence of about 1000bp of the knockout vector sequence of homologous recombination, using PCR technology around flanking sequence, the correct sequence, respectively, after the reorganization of the Agrobacterium-mediated transformation vector pBI-G3CN to construct by Agrobacterium-mediated transformation of Sclerotinia sclerotiorum knockout vector ofâ–³pBI-G3CN-MAT, and transformed to Agrobacterium tumefaciens EHA105 cells shocks in.In short, this study has been successfully cloned Sclerotinia sclerotiorum MAT mating type gene sequences flanking the left and right, build the MAT mating type gene knockout vector ofâ–³pBI-G3CN-MAT. The first use of Sclerotinia sclerotiorum ascospores establish Agrobacterium-mediated genetic Sclerotinia sclerotiorum into the system, and optimize the system conditions for the development of new pesticides and laid the foundation for disease prevention and control.
